Google AI Tools are a suite of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ning services provided by Google Cloud and other Google platforms. They enable developers, data scientists, and businesses to build, train, deploy, and manage AI models efficiently. These tools support a wide range of applications including natural language processing, computer vision, data analytics, and predictive modeling.

Key Google AI Tools
1. Vertex AI
- Unified platform for building, training, and deploying ML models
- Supports AutoML for automated model creation
- Integrates with BigQuery, AI notebooks, and pipelines
2. Google Cloud AI APIs
- Vision AI: Image and video analysis, object detection, facial recognition
- Natural Language AI: Text analysis, entity recognition, sentiment analysis, summarization
- Translation AI: Real-time and batch translation across multiple languages
- Speech-to-Text & Text-to-Speech: Convert speech to text and vice versa for applications
3. BigQuery ML
- Enables ML directly in SQL for large-scale datasets
- Supports regression, classification, and clustering
- Ideal for business intelligence and analytics applications
4. AutoML
- Custom ML model building without extensive coding
- Supports image, video, text, and tabular data
- Automatically selects optimal model architectures and hyperparameters
5. AI Hub & Notebooks
- Repository of pre-built models, pipelines, and datasets
- Jupyter-based notebooks for experimentation and development
How Google AI Tools Work
- Data Collection & Storage
- Store structured or unstructured data in Google Cloud Storage or BigQuery
- Model Training
- Use AutoML or custom TensorFlow/PyTorch models on Vertex AI
- Train models with large datasets efficiently using cloud GPUs/TPUs
- Deployment & Serving
- Deploy models as APIs or endpoints for real-time predictions
- Integrate with web apps, dashboards, or mobile applications
- Monitoring & Optimization
- Monitor model performance, detect drift, and retrain models as needed
Applications of Google AI Tools
- Customer Support: AI chatbots and automated ticketing systems
- Healthcare: Medical image analysis and predictive diagnostics
- Retail & Marketing: Product recommendation, sales forecasting, customer segmentation
- Finance: Fraud detection, risk assessment, and predictive analytics
- Media & Entertainment: Content moderation, video tagging, and personalization
- Operations: Supply chain optimization and predictive maintenance
